Hydrogen-bonded supramolecular assemblies of novel 18-crown-6 with guanidinium and aminoguanidinium thiosulfates: synthesis, crystal structures, spectroscopic characterization, and topological features

Formation of guanidinium and 4-aminoguanidinium cations with 18-crown-6 ether was observed upon interaction of the respective thiosulfates and crown ether. The new compounds [(CN3H6)2(C12H24O6)][(CN3H6)2(C12H24O6)(H2O)2](S2O3)2 (1) and [(CN4H7)2(C12H24O6)]2(S2O3) (2), have been characterized by single-crystal and powder diffraction, IR and Raman spectroscopy, and topological analysis.
